25.01.2022 Before and after a Dental scale and polish! Proper dental care will help keep your pet from developing a wide variety of dental health issues, such as periodontal disease, which is caused by the build-up of bacteria in the mouth. These bacteria form a film over the teeth called plaque. As the bacteria die, they can become calcified by the calcium in your pets saliva. The calcified plaque is called tartar, and it can eventually lead to gingivitis, which can lead to an infection in the root of the tooth. Call us now for your FREE dental check!

21.01.2022 Teddy came into the Clinic a couple weeks ago for a standard consultation and vaccinations. Dr Stephanie noticed when listening to his heart she could hear a Murmur. Teddy was booked in straight away for an ultrasound of his heart (Echo). An Echocardiogram, also known as an echo or cardiac ultrasound, is a diagnostic tool for looking closely at the heart as well as inside and around it. An echo uses high frequency sound waves to create live images, allowing veterinarians to ...get an idea of what the heart looks like and how it is functioning in real time. The echo can show if the heart is working properly, and if not, what the problem is. Medications and treatments for heart disease are tailored to the individual, so understanding the problem correctly helps provide the best treatment. Echocardiograms can also be used to determine if treatments are helping or if a change in dosage or new medications are required. See more

17.01.2022 We often take care of our own teeth by visiting the dentist for a 6 monthly scale and polish in the chair. Did you know that we should be doing the same thing for our pets? Of course, our pets dont understand that we want them to sit in the chair and hold their mouth open whilst staying very still. This is why our pets need an anaesthetic when we perform a dental scale and polish for them. A prophylactic dental scale and polish is recommended to prevent periodontal disease... something which affects 80% of cats and dogs over three years of age. If periodontal disease is present, it is essential that dental treatment is performed to treat painful gingivitis and remove any teeth which could be a source of pain. It is important to remember that our pets age up to seven times as fast us humans do, so your pet having a scale and polish once a year is really the equivalent to us having a dental check once every seven years. 12.01.2022 Tick season is here! Do you know what a paralysis tick looks like? Tick paralysis is a potentially fatal disease and the prognosis is guarded and dependent on the severity of signs. The earlier the treatment with tick antiserum, the greater the prognosis.... The best way to prevent tick paralysis is to use tick control products (eg. Bravecto, Nexgard) and thoroughly checking pets daily and removing any ticks. This could save your fur babys life!

05.01.2022 REMEMBER YOUR PETS OVER NEW YEARS!! . Pets, especially dogs, can get very frightened from loud noises like FIREWORKS!. . New years can be very difficult for dog owners due to the firework celebrations... . Here are some precautions you can take and tips to keep in mind to make sure your pets is protected during the fireworks! . 1. Dogs are known to jump and try to escape when there are fireworks happening. Many dogs have fled their homes or owner's arms during New Years Celebrations. To avoid this, keep your dog in the quiet indoors! . 2. Leave your pet in the home of a friend or a pet sitter if you plan on heading out. If your pet isn't familiar with this place. Get a pet sitter to come to your place! . 3. Make sure your pet's microchip is up to date, or (at least) make sure your dog has a pet ID tag. Since many dogs run away out of fear, taking precautions could make sure your dog gets back to your home. Pet shelters are always finding runaway dogs on this holiday, so make sure your dog has proper identification. . 4. If your dog often gets extremely upset at loud noises like thunder, talk to the vet and consider anxiety medication! This is a great way to help keep your dog calm. . 5. Dogs often bite and chew on things out of fear, so remove any important or dangerous items from your home that your dog could potentially bite. . 6. If you lose your dog or find another dog, take them to your local vet to get them microchip checked. . 7. Don't let your dog outside without a leash this weekend. They are likely to bolt from the noise, so keep them on a leash at all times. . 8. Thunder Jackets . 9. Over the counter natural medications such as Adaptil, Feliway and Zylkene . Call your vet today for any further advice! #newyearseve #fireworks #protectyourpet

01.01.2022 Our patient of the week goes to...... Mr. Red Hope!!! . Red arrived at our clinic in a critical condition. He was seizuring and hypersalivating and had no control of his movements! . It was suspected by his owner that he had ingested a cane toad as Red was known to be a serial toad chaser and was displaying all symptoms that would indicate cane toad toxicity. ... . He was rushed straight out to the back into our treatment room and treated accordingly by our amazing team! . Cane toad poisoning in pets can be VERY serious and potentially a FATAL occurrence! If you suspect your animal has ingested or licked a cane toad please take them to a vet IMMEDIATELY! . On the way to the vet you can wipe your pets mouth out with a damp clean cloth. . Don't put hoses down your pets throat as this could cause more damage than benefit, just continue to wipe your dog’s mouth out with clean damp cloths until you arrive at the vet clinic. If possible call the vet first to let them know you are arriving so they can be prepared. But if it is not possible to contact them in a timely matter, do not panic just go directly there!! This time Red was very lucky! Red is now at home recovering with his mummy and keeping well away from any jumping toxic amphibians!!
